Michael Funke


Michael Funke is a German auto racing driver.

Career

Funke finished third in the German Touring Car Challenge in 1999 and 2000, and was runner-up in 2001. The championship became the DMSB Produktionswagen Meisterschaft in 2004, and Funke finished third for Hotfiel Sport.
Hotfiel moved to the new World [Touring Car Championship] in 2005, and Funke was test and reserve driver. He replaced Thomas Jäger for the final five rounds of the season, scoring a best finish of tenth position.
Funke has since competed in ADAC GT Masters.
